Internal Memo — Archive Film Reels

Heads up: the six restored film reels from the Copperfield Archive project are finally back from Lanternworks Restoration and they look great. They're in the climate case in the back office — please don't move it near the radiators. A courier from Swiftmere is booked for Friday to take them to the archive vault in Dunmoor. Keep the case upright at all times. The confidential courier hand-over instruction appears just below.

dispatch memo: the sorwyn zorius courier leaves the holvan pelath fenys aldion pelius norys sorael ralax ledger at gate 7538 under passcode 456872

- [ ] **Step 7: Breaker override escrow.** After sealing the signing keys for the Tallgrove upstream API circuit breaker, confirm the support team can force the breaker open during a full outage. The override bundle lives in the sealed escrow drawer and is useless without its unlock phrase. Two ceremony witnesses must initial this step before proceeding. The escrow bundle is decrypted with the recovery passphrase that follows.

vault phrase of kahip-kahop = holath-quenmir

Meeting notes — Trial Plot Logistics, Thursday session. Confirmed that the Verdane Agronomics seed samples for the Hollowmere trial plot are packed in six sealed trays, each labeled by cultivar and moisture-checked this morning. Trays must stay upright and out of direct sun during transit; the cooler van from Bramfield Depot is reserved. Driver should arrive at the plot gate no later than 09:30, as the field technician leaves at ten. Please pass the following instruction to the courier verbatim.

dispatch memo: the eliok quenok courier leaves the sorael aldath belion tammir casix gileth queniel jorath ledger at gate 9299 under passcode 897989